Vue.js是一種流行的JavaScript框架,用于構建現代化的Web應用程序。
在Vue.js之上,有許多工具和庫可供使用,以擴展該框架的功能。
其中之一是Axios,它是一個基于Promise的HTTP客戶端,可用于在Vue.js應用程序中進行數據交換。
Axios具有多個功能,如支持Promise API,攔截請求和響應,轉換請求和響應數據等。
在Vue.js中安裝Axios很容易,只需使用npm安裝Axios:
npm install axios --save
一旦安裝了Axios,我們可以使用它來執行GET和POST請求,并處理它們的響應。
例如,下面是一個使用Axios在Vue.js中獲取數據的簡短示例:
axios.get('/api/mydata') .then(response =>{ this.myData = response.data; }) .catch(error =>{ console.log(error); });
上述代碼段獲取一個名為mydata的API終端點,并將數據存儲在Vue.js組件的myData屬性中。
如您所見,使用Axios在Vue.js中執行HTTP請求是一件相當簡單的事情,而且它的功能和靈活性使它成為Vue.js應用程序中的一個必不可少的部分。
下一篇vue jsfddle